Aequor is now hiring a full-time Board Certified Behavior Analyst (BCBA) for the 2023-2024 school year
Responsibilities:
• Participation in the team development of Behavior Support Plans (BSPs) compliant with guidance provided through the state guidelines, including completion of Functional Behavioral Assessments and/or Analyses.
• Leadership role in the implementation of BSPs with fidelity.
• Support a classroom environment that fosters imbedded communication and social skills.
• Implement individual and classroom-wide strategies, interventions, etc. to increase adaptive behaviors and the development of functionally equivalent alternative responses.
• Collect, monitor, graph and analyze student data.
• Maintain a schedule for direct work with students
• Support parent training, as a part of a team, to facilitate the use of appropriate supportive strategies within home and community settings.
• Confer with parents on an ongoing basis and as a part of the collaborative team.
Requirements:
• Master's Degree in Behavior Analysis
• Board Certification in Behavior Analysis
